Is Lowfat yoghurt Halal?

Yes, Lowfat yoghurt is Halal. Based on a detailed analysis of its ingredients—cultured low fat milk, fruit pectin, and standard vitamins—there are no animal-derived additives or alcohol present. This makes it a compliant choice for those adhering to Halal dietary guidelines.

The Ingredient Breakdown

When determining if a dairy product is Halal, we look beyond the milk itself to the additives and processing agents. For this Lowfat yoghurt, the ingredient list is remarkably clean from a Halal perspective.

First, the base is cultured pasteurized low fat milk. Milk is inherently Halal, and the bacterial cultures used to ferment it (S. thermophilus, L. bulgaricus, etc.) are microscopic organisms grown on dairy or vegetable mediums, not animal sources.

The thickening agent is fruit pectin. This is a plant-based soluble fiber extracted from citrus peels or apples. It is a 100% plant-derived ingredient and poses no Halal concerns. Similarly, the added vitamins, vitamin A acetate and vitamin D3, are synthetically produced or derived from plant/fungal sources in modern food manufacturing, making them safe for consumption.

There are no red flags such as gelatin (often from pork or non-Halal beef), rennet, or alcohol-based flavorings. Therefore, the formulation passes the Halal assessment.


Nutritional Value

From a nutritional standpoint, this Lowfat yoghurt is designed to be a lighter alternative to full-fat varieties. By removing the cream, the caloric density is significantly reduced, which fits well into calorie-controlled diets.

While the specific sugar content isn't listed in the provided ingredients, standard lowfat yoghurts often contain added sugars to improve palatability. However, the presence of live and active cultures offers significant digestive health benefits, aiding in gut microbiome balance. It serves as an excellent source of protein and calcium relative to its calorie count, making it a nutrient-dense snack that supports bone health and satiety without the heavy fat content of whole milk yoghurt.
